Vegetarian BBQ Recipes for Labor Day
Easy and mouthwatering BBQ recipe straight from India. With a little preparation beforehand you can make this Indian delicacy Paneer Tikka with mint chutney with absolute ease. A definite crowd pleaser.
For Paneer Tikka
Paneer 1 lb
Red Bell Pepper 1
Green Bell Pepper 1
Squash (Optional) 1
Red Onion 1
Yogurt ¼ cup
Shan Tandoori Mix 1 tbs
Lemon juice 2 tbs
Red Chilli Powder 1 tsp
Salt to taste
Wooden Skewers 8-10
Paneer is available in most Indian grocery stores. In US its usually frozen. This recipe works well with frozen paneer but is best with fresh paneer. If time permits prepare it at home. Paneer is same as Cottage Cheese but the only difference is that for this recipe you need blocks rather than crumps.
Cut Paneer in 1 inch cubes. Dice Red and Green bell pepper into similar size squares. Slice Squash in thick slices. Quarter one big red onion and separate the layers.
In the yogurt mix Shan Tandoori Mix which is easily available in Indian grocery store. To this mixture add lemon juice, Red chilli powder as per your taste. If you do not like lot of heat you may not add this. Taste the mixture. Add salt if needed. Shan Tandoori mix has little salt already added to the mixture. Now in a bowl add this mixture and slowly add Paneer Pieces. Marinate it for about 2 hours. Just before heading for BBQ add the Bell peppers and Red Onion. Arrange Paneer, bell peppers, squash and onion alternatively in water soaked skewers. Grill them for 5-8 minutes rotating in between so that they are cooked properly. Serve hot and enjoy with mint chutney.
Mint Chutney
Coriander leaves - 1 bunch
Mint leaves - ¾ bunch
Garlic - 5 cloves
Ginger --1 inch piece
Green Chilli -6 ( to taste)
Water --2-3 tbs
Cumin Powder -1 tsp
Amchur Powder - 1
Yogurt- 1 cup
Salt - 2 tsp (to taste)
Blend all the ingredients except Yogurt in the blender. Once blended, take it out in a container. Since we have to add yogurt the container should be big. Add yogurt till it is light green in color and you reach the desired consistency. Add salt to taste.
